In triangle ABC, angle CAB = 26 degrees, angle ACB = 64 degrees. Segment AD is perpendicular to the plane of triangle ABC. Determine the angle between straight lines BD and BC.

In a given triangle ABC, the sum of two acute angles is 90 ° (26 ° + 64 °). We conclude that triangle ABC is rectangular, angle B = 90 °. AB is perpendicular to BC.
We get:
AB is perpendicular to BC.
AD – perpendicular to the ABC plane (by condition);
BD – oblique;
AB – projection of the inclined BD on the plane.
According to the three perpendicular theorem, we have the following:
The projection AB is perpendicular to the straight line BC, then the inclined BD is perpendicular to the straight line BC.
Answer: the angle between straight lines BD and BC is 90 °.
